Calorimetry In Industry. Calorimetry is used to measure the transfer and exchange of heat. A calorimeter is a device used to measure the amount of heat involved in a chemical or physical process. Calorimetry is used in various industries to measure the heat of chemical reactions or physical changes. It is a technique that has applications in different research and industrial sectors.
